HealthQwest provides professionally supervised Methadone maintenance and medical withdrawal as a licensed Narcotic Treatment Program (NTP) in the state of Georgia.
As such, HealthQwest seeks to provide holistic rehabilitation services for patients 18 years of age or older and who are opiate dependant and are currently residing in Warner Robbins and/or the surrounding counties. HealthQwest is pleased to offer an array of services to those seeking treatment, such as, medical and psychiatric evaluations and referrals; individual, group, and specialized counseling; case management; crisis intervention; and the provision of comprehensive coordination of care among other providers.
The primary goal of HealthQwest is to promote and support abstinence from opiates and all illicit drugs. Methadone Maintenance Treatment is also used to achieve the secondary goal of decreasing high risk behavior such as IV drug use, unsafe sex, illegal activity, and overdose. The range of services offered by HealthQwest should allow each patient to achieve stability and recovery in all aspects of their lives.

Methadone maintenance treatment, a program in which addicted individuals receive daily doses of methadone, was initially developed during the 1960s as part of a broad, multicomponent treatment program that also emphasized resocialization and vocational training.
